Functions of muscle tissue

producing movement

stabilizing body position

storing substances

generate heat

move substances through the body

2
New cards

Properties of muscle

electrical excitability

contractility

extensibility

elasticity

3
New cards

3 types of muscle

skeletal, cardiac, smooth,

what does cardiac muscle look like

branching, striated, generally uninucleated cells that interdigitate

5
New cards

function of cardiac muscle

contracts to propel blood into the circulation, involuntary control

6
New cards

where are the cardiac muscles located in the body

the walls of the heart

7
New cards

what does smooth muscle look like

spindle shaped cells with a central nuclei, no striations, cells arranged closely to form sheets

8
New cards

function of smooth muscles

propels substance or objects along internal passageways, involuntary

9
New cards

location of smooth muscle

mostly on the walls of hollow organs like intestines

10
New cards

properties of smooth muscles

involuntary, no t-tubules, srcoplasmic reticulum contacts sarcolemma, no sarcomeres, intermediate filaments attach to dense bodies instead
